Performance Review is an exhibition that runs like a live system: artworks are made, judged, and discussed through the same machinery that normally manages work. Right now one work, CR-0002, has reached the point where the system is waiting for a human final decision, so the show is not just displaying art but exposing how choice and authority operate inside production.
